Stand Together Against Racism (S.T.A.R), in partnership with The Glass House and the Carriage Barn Arts Center, is hosting its third annual "Through Your Looking Glass" student art showcase. This event celebrates how art, design, and architecture can promote social justice, inclusion, equity, and diversity.

Students of all ages from Fairfield County, CT, including college students, are invited to submit art that reflects a social justice topic that's important to them. (Check out the S.T.A.R website to see what other students have submitted.) We welcome all forms of art, such as paintings, drawings, photography, mixed media, sculpture, videos (including TikTok-style), or architectural designs. Students must write a short description of what their art means to them. This description will be shown next to their art at the showcase gallery. This showcase is not a competition—all student artwork will be displayed at the Carriage Barn Arts Center in New Canaan starting with an opening reception on Saturday, November 16. All artists, with their families and friends should plan to attend. The showcase will remain up funtil 11/24.
